Two Golden Globe nominations for TBBT

The Big Bang Theory is nominated for two Golden Globe awards, the Hollywood Foreign press Association evealed today as it announced the nominees for the 71st annual Golden Globe Awards.

The Big Bang Theory is nominated in the Best Television Series - Musical or Comedy category. This the show's third nomination. The other nominees for the award are Brooklyn Nine-Nine, Girls, Modern Family and Parks and Recreation.

Jim Parsons is nominated for the Best Actor in a Television Series - Musical or Comedy category. This is his third nomination for the award, which he won in 2010. The other contenders this year are Jason Bateman, Don Cheadle, Michael J. Fox and Andy Samberg.

The Golden Globe Awards ceremony will take place January 12, 2014 and will be broadcast live on NBC. For the second consecutive year, the ceremony will be hosted by Tina Fey and Amy Poehler.

The Big Bang Theory receives 3 SAG Award nominations

The Big Bang Theory is nominated in three categories for the 20th Screen Actors Guild Awards, it was announced today.

The Big Bang Theory's cast was nominated in the Outstanding Performance by an Ensemble in a Comedy Series category. This is The Big Bang Theory's third consecutive nomination for this award. The other shows nominated are 30 Rock, Arrested Development, Modern Family and Veep.

Jim Parsons received his second consecutive nomination for the Outstanding Performance by a Male Actor in a Comedy Series award. The other contenders for the award are 30 Rock's Alec Baldwin, Arrested Development's Jason Bateman, Modern Family's Ty Burrell and House of Lies' Don Cheadle.

Mayim Bialik was nominated for the Outstanding Performance by a Female Actor in a Comedy Series for the first time. The other nominees are Modern Family's Julie Bowen, Nurse Jackie's Edie Falco, 30 Rock's Tina Fey and Veep's Julia Louis-Dreyfus.

The 20th Annual Screen Actors Guild Awards will be simulcast live on TNT and TBS on Saturday, January 18 at 8pm EST. There will also be a live stream on the TBS and TNT websites and through the Watch TBS and Watch TNT apps for iOS and Android.

7.12 'The Hesitation Ramification' Press Release

CBS has issued the press release for the first The Big Bang Theory episode of 2014, which will air January 2.

The Hesitation Ramification – When Penny’s big acting break on NCIS is a bust, Leonard struggles to help her, which results in Penny asking Leonard a bold relationship question. Meanwhile, Sheldon tries to learn how to be funny and Raj tries to work on his “game” before talking to girls, on THE BIG BANG THEORY, Thursday, Jan. 2 (8:00 – 8:31 PM, ET/PT) on the CBS Television Network.

7.10 'The Discovery Dissipation' Ratings

Last night's episode of The Big Bang Theory slipped to second place in some ratings, faced with extraordinarily strong competition from NBC's The Sound of Music Live! Despite the tougher competition, The Big Bang Theory still finished first in the adults 18-49 demographic for its time slot.

"The Discovery Dissipation" was watched by 15.63 million people. The show's audience was down by 3.31 million people from the last original episode on November 21 and was a season low. The Big Bang Theory placed second in viewers and households behind NBC's The Sound of Music Live! NBC's musical broadcast averaged 18.62 million viewers over its three hour broadcast, peaking in the 8:30-9:00 time period.

The Big Bang Theory maintained its lead position in the 18-49 demo in its time slot. This week's episode scored a 4.8/14 rating, down five tenths from the previous episode to a season low. The Big Bang Theory had a .4 lead on The Sound of Music Live!'s 4.4/13 in the shared half hour. The Big Bang Theory also topped the NBC musical's average rating of 4.6/13 in the 18-49 demo across its three-hour broadcast, though the ratings for TSOML's later half-hours are set to be the night's highest ratings in the demo.
